Washington, DC. -
The Cardinals opened the game tonight with a quick jumper only
to be answered by Villa's Cilk McSweeney (Ft.
Lauderdale , FL / Dillard). Jason Lambert
(Bloomfield , CT / Kingswood ) went three-for-three on
three-pointers, two of which tied the game for the Mustangs.
Villa took the lead at 8:26 when Kerry Dugan
(Sparks , MD / Hereford ) hit a crucial lay-up to make the score
25-23.
The Cardinals continued to give the Mustangs a hard battle until
the buzzer. Steve Segears (Lanham , MD / St.
Johns College HS) hit a lay-up with a minute left in the half to
give Villa the lead 36-35. Catholic rebounded the ball off of
a jumper and took the lead seconds before the half ended
37-35.
The second half opened up with a quick dunk by Catholic to set
the pace for the Cardinals. Anatoly Smolkin
(Pikesville , MD / Pikesville ) made two free-throws to close the
gap to 51-49 and followed it up with a steal at 10:36 to give the
Mustangs momentum. In turn, Greg Woody
(Baltimore , MD / Mt. St. Joseph 's) caused a Catholic turnover
with eight minutes left in the game.
Phil Williams (District Heights , MD / Bishop
McNamara) hit a three-pointer with five minutes left in the game
and Segears hit two lay-ups in a row but it was
not enough to give the Mustangs the lead. After many fouls
and a dunk by Catholic's Patrick Dwyer, the Cardinals won the game
77-67.
Lambert led the team with 18 points and four
assists, followed by Segears and
McSweeney, both with double-doubles.
Segears had 14 points and 11 boards and
McSweeney had 10 points and 10 boards.
Additionally, Dugan contributed 14 total points to
the game.
